Fire juggler

After the woman I showed the last two days performed her fire twirling routine, this man juggled clubs on fire, including tossing the burning clubs up with his foot.

It is common that cowboy trouboudors walk around from restaurant to restaurant singing for tips in Tamarindo. I guess these fire jugglers are trying the same technique.

I like taking night photos using available light, although it is tough to do without a tripod, as this photo shows, as the torches were the only source of light.
